17db96d56Sopenharmony_ci// Simple namespace object interface 27db96d56Sopenharmony_ci 37db96d56Sopenharmony_ci#ifndef Py_INTERNAL_NAMESPACE_H 47db96d56Sopenharmony_ci#define Py_INTERNAL_NAMESPACE_H 57db96d56Sopenharmony_ci#ifdef __cplusplus 67db96d56Sopenharmony_ciextern "C" { 77db96d56Sopenharmony_ci#endif 87db96d56Sopenharmony_ci 97db96d56Sopenharmony_ci#ifndef Py_BUILD_CORE 107db96d56Sopenharmony_ci# error "this header requires Py_BUILD_CORE define" 117db96d56Sopenharmony_ci#endif 127db96d56Sopenharmony_ci 137db96d56Sopenharmony_ciPyAPI_DATA(PyTypeObject) _PyNamespace_Type; 147db96d56Sopenharmony_ci 157db96d56Sopenharmony_ciPyAPI_FUNC(PyObject *) _PyNamespace_New(PyObject *kwds); 167db96d56Sopenharmony_ci 177db96d56Sopenharmony_ci#ifdef __cplusplus 187db96d56Sopenharmony_ci} 197db96d56Sopenharmony_ci#endif 207db96d56Sopenharmony_ci#endif // !Py_INTERNAL_NAMESPACE_H 21